If you’re a homeowner in Irondale, Alabama, and you have trees on your property, chances are you’ll need the services of an arborist at some point. An arborist is a trained professional who specializes in the care and maintenance of trees. From tree trimming and pruning to tree removal and disease diagnosis, an arborist plays a crucial role in keeping your trees healthy and your property safe.
However, with so many arborists to choose from in Irondale, it can be overwhelming to find the right one for your specific needs. To help you make an informed decision, here are some key factors to consider when choosing the right arborist in Irondale, Alabama:
1. Certification and Credentials: The first thing you should look for when choosing an arborist is their certification and credentials. A certified arborist has undergone training and passed exams to demonstrate their knowledge and expertise in tree care. Look for an arborist who is certified by the International Society of Arboriculture (ISA) or the Tree Care Industry Association (TCIA).
2. Experience and Expertise: Experience matters when it comes to tree care. Look for an arborist who has years of experience working with trees in Irondale, Alabama. An experienced arborist will have the skills and knowledge to assess the health of your trees, recommend the right course of action, and perform tree care services safely and effectively.
3. Reputation and Reviews: Before hiring an arborist, take the time to research their reputation and read reviews from past clients. A reputable arborist will have positive testimonials and reviews that attest to their professionalism, reliability, and quality of work. You can also ask for references and contact previous clients to get firsthand feedback on their experience.
4. Services Offered: Different arborists may specialize in different services, so make sure the arborist you choose offers the specific services you need. Whether you need tree trimming, pruning, removal, stump grinding, or tree health assessments, ensure that the arborist has the expertise and equipment to handle the job.
5. Insurance and Safety Practices: Tree care can be a dangerous job, so it’s essential to hire an arborist who prioritizes safety. Make sure the arborist is properly insured and follows industry safety standards to protect both their workers and your property. Ask about their safety practices and equipment to ensure that the job is done safely and efficiently.
Choosing the right arborist in Irondale, Alabama, is essential for maintaining the health and beauty of your trees. By considering factors such as certification, experience, reputation, services offered, and safety practices, you can make an informed decision and hire a qualified arborist who will help you care for your trees for years to come.
